I want my users run a predefined Crystal Report without them having access to the Crystal Reporting itself.


Anyway, i found the CREXPORT.EXE batch command and to be the ideal solution. It ideally exports to a PDF which the user then prints off..

All was working well until i inserted a sub-report to one of the reports which now doesn't work.

Is there any way round this? What am i doing wrong?
